About 3 Lincoln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Lincoln Street is a mid-terrace house in Llandysul (SA44 4B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 171 m² (around 1841 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2014)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in February 2010 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from October 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Across 1998–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£231,000 is 28.3% above the 2021 sale price. Most recent transfer: March 2021 at £180,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
